Abstract

This report describes a case of hepatocellular carcinoma in an adolescent with perinatally acquired HIV and hepatitis B virus coinfection, arising despite more than a decade of suppressive antiretroviral therapy for both HIV and hepatitis B virus. This case raises important questions regarding optimal hepatocellular carcinoma screening in this high-risk group and the oncogenic potential of even very well-controlled viral infection.
